Pinch bowls are very small bowls specifically designed to hold a single ingredient or condiment. They are often referred to as “condiment cups”, too. They have a smooth, seamless inside so ingredient don’t catch on them, and can be easily added to pots, skillets, woks, and plates.

Dishes — plates, bowls, and cups — are crockery. If you don’t have a dishwasher, you’ll have to wash all the crockery from your dinner party by hand. Crockery most often refers to everyday ceramic tableware, rather than fine, expensive china.What is coupe bowl?
A Coupe Cereal Bowl is a Cereal Bowl without a lip around the top. … The name “coupe” means “cut off” in French and means the missing rim, in the case of a Coupe Bowl, which is makes it a less formal piece of tableware.

What do you call a small bowl for sauce?
Although there is a strict definition of a ramekin, the term has evolved to encompass a number of different but related items. So, you may call them sauce cups, cheese pipkins, oyster cups, monkey dishes, or souffle cups. All of these items are often collectively referred to as “ramekins.”
What is a small bowl size?
Smaller bowls range from 3” to 6” in diameter and commonly serve light appetizers or single-serving foods. Medium bowls range from 7” to 10” in diameter and commonly serve light snacks, heavy appetizers, or dipping sauces.

What is a coup plate?
Coupe plates are flat, rimless plates but with a slight concave that is sometimes referred to as a flat bowl. The minimalist aesthetic of a coupe plate delivers a blank canvas that will naturally draw the eye to the food rather than what it’s being served on.

What is a coupe platter?
Coupe-shaped plates have no rim and accommodate the way food is cooked and served in the East. … To allow space for the courses on one plate, the diameter of the coupe-shaped dinner plate is approximately 1 inch larger than that of the rim-shaped dinner plate.
What are Japanese bowls called?
There are many different kinds of bowls used in the traditional Japanese table setting. There are soup bowls or Shiruwan (汁椀), small bowls, rice bowls or Ochawan in Japanese (お茶碗), and even ramen bowls or ramen Bachi (ラーメン鉢).

What is a dining bowl?
A dining bowl, sometimes called a dinner bowl, is a plate-sized bowl that can hold your entire dinner, from pasta to soup, without spilling it. Dining bowls are very versatile and cradle your food while being large enough to operate a fork and knife without any hindrance.
What are Lignoid bowls?
The LIGNOID is an outdoor bowl with a wide draw and very popular with short mat bowlers. Predominately an outdoor bowl with a wide draw and ideal for all conditions. It is popular with short mat bowlers who need a bigger drawing bowl but is not suitable for faster indoor surfaces.

How do I know what size lawn bowls to buy?
One way to get the right size, shape and weight is to wrap both of your hands around the widest running surface of a bowl so that your middle fingers touch at the bottom and if your thumbs touch at the top that is your size.
What does WB mean on lawn bowls?
IBB is now called World Bowls (WB). The Australian stamp was dropped in 1993 when all bowls were stamped with the oval WB stamp which is now stamped on all bowls.
